What you need to know
Short-term letting is legal in Dubai but regulated: you need a holiday home permit from the Department of Economy and Tourism, and the unit must be registered. Operating without one carries penalties, so factor the permit in from the start rather than treating it as optional.
The headline comparison usually favours short-let, sometimes dramatically. What narrows the gap is the cost stack: platform commission around 15%, cleaning on every changeover, and utilities, which on a short-let are the host's responsibility rather than the tenant's.
Occupancy is the variable that decides it. Dubai runs strongly seasonal — high through winter, materially softer through summer. A location that achieves 80% annually is a different business to one achieving 55%, and the difference is usually location and how actively the listing is managed.
Common questions
Is Airbnb legal in Dubai?
Yes, with a holiday home permit from the Department of Economy and Tourism. The unit must be registered and operating without a permit carries penalties.
Is short-term letting more profitable in Dubai?
Often, in strong tourist locations with good occupancy. The gap narrows considerably once platform fees, cleaning, utilities and the permit are deducted.
What occupancy should I expect?
65–80% annually in prime tourist areas, materially lower elsewhere. Dubai is strongly seasonal, peaking in winter.
